Geological Richness of Mpumalanga
The geological landscape of Mpumalanga is characterized by its position on the Kaapvaal Craton, a stable ancient geological formation that hosts some of the world’s most significant mineral deposits. The Bushveld Igneous Complex, one of the largest geological structures on Earth, extends into Mpumalanga, making it exceptionally rich in platinum group metals, chromium, vanadium, and other associated minerals. Additionally, the Witwatersrand Basin, famous for its gold deposits, also influences Mpumalanga’s mineral wealth. Coal mining is another cornerstone of the Mpumalanga economy, with vast reserves supporting both domestic energy needs and significant export markets. The province’s diverse geology supports the extraction of a wide spectrum of minerals, from precious metals like gold and platinum to industrial minerals such as silica sand, limestone, and phosphate rock.

Types of Mines Available for Sale in Mpumalanga
When exploring mines for sale in Mpumalanga, investors will encounter a diverse range of mining operations, each catering to different mineral commodities and investment strategies. Understanding these types is crucial for aligning your acquisition with your business objectives. From large-scale industrial mineral operations to niche precious metal ventures, Mpumalanga offers a broad spectrum of opportunities. These operations vary in scale, operational maturity, and the specific minerals they extract, influencing the investment required and the potential returns.
- Coal Mines: Mpumalanga is renowned for its extensive coal reserves. Mines for sale in this category range from opencast operations to underground mines, supplying thermal coal for power generation and metallurgical coal for industrial processes.
- Gold Mines: While historically significant, gold mining in Mpumalanga continues to offer opportunities, particularly in regions with proven gold-bearing reefs. These can include both active mines and potential redevelopment sites.
- Platinum Group Metal (PGM) Mines: Leveraging the Bushveld Igneous Complex, PGM mines are a significant segment of Mpumalanga’s mining landscape. These operations focus on extracting platinum, palladium, rhodium, and other associated PGMs, which are critical for catalytic converters and other industrial applications.
- Chrome and Vanadium Mines: Also linked to the Bushveld Complex, chrome and vanadium mines are available, supplying essential materials for stainless steel production and advanced alloys.
- Industrial Mineral Mines: Mpumalanga also boasts deposits of industrial minerals like limestone (for cement production), silica sand (for glass manufacturing), gypsum (for construction materials), and phosphate rock (for fertilizers). Mines for sale in this category often serve local industries and offer stable, long-term demand.
- Exploration and Greenfield Projects: For investors with a higher risk appetite and a long-term vision, exploration licenses and undeveloped mineral prospects represent an opportunity to discover and develop new resource bases.
The selection of the appropriate mine type depends heavily on market demand, commodity prices, technological requirements, and the investor’s specific expertise and financial capacity. Key Factors to Consider
- Mineral Resource Evaluation: Conduct independent geological assessments to verify the quantity, quality, and grade of the mineral reserves. Understand the mine’s production history and potential for expansion.
- Operational Status and Infrastructure: Evaluate the current state of the mine’s equipment, infrastructure (processing plants, power supply, water, accommodation), and its operational efficiency. Assess the need for upgrades or new investments.
- Regulatory and Environmental Compliance: Thoroughly review all mining rights, permits, environmental impact assessments, and rehabilitation liabilities. Ensure full compliance with South African mining and environmental laws.
- Market Demand and Pricing: Analyze the global and local market demand for the specific minerals the mine produces. Understand current and projected commodity prices and their impact on profitability.
- Financial Viability: Perform a comprehensive financial analysis, including projected operating costs, capital expenditures, revenue forecasts, and profitability metrics. Assess the return on investment (ROI) and payback period.
- Management and Labor: Evaluate the existing management team and workforce. Consider the availability of skilled labor in the region and labor relations history.
- Logistics and Accessibility: Assess the mine’s proximity to transportation infrastructure (roads, rail, ports) for efficient movement of raw materials and finished products.

Pricing Factors
Several key elements contribute to the overall price of a mine for sale in Mpumalanga: the quantity and quality (grade) of the mineral reserves; the type of mineral being extracted (precious metals, base metals, industrial minerals, coal); the mine’s current operational status (producing, development, exploration); the age and condition of existing infrastructure and equipment; the complexity and cost of extraction methods required; ongoing operational costs, including labor, energy, and consumables; environmental compliance costs and potential rehabilitation liabilities; market demand and current commodity prices; and the remaining economic life of the mine.
Average Cost Ranges
Providing precise average cost ranges for mines for sale in Mpumalanga is challenging due to the unique nature of each asset. However, general indications can be made: small-scale industrial mineral sites or exploration prospects might range from a few hundred thousand to a few million US dollars. Established coal or base metal mines with significant infrastructure and proven reserves can command tens to hundreds of millions of US dollars. High-value PGM or gold mines, particularly those with large reserves and advanced processing capabilities, can reach into the hundreds of millions or even billions of dollars. The presence of JORC (or equivalent) compliant resource reports significantly influences valuation.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Buying Mines in Mpumalanga
The acquisition of mines for sale in Mpumalanga, while potentially lucrative, is fraught with complexities. Avoiding common pitfalls is crucial for ensuring a successful and profitable investment. Many buyers overlook critical aspects, leading to unexpected costs, operational disruptions, or failure to achieve projected returns. Here are key mistakes to steer clear of:
- Inadequate Due Diligence: Rushing the acquisition process without comprehensive geological, environmental, legal, and financial due diligence is the most significant mistake. This can lead to acquiring assets with hidden liabilities, depleted reserves, or insurmountable operational challenges.
- Underestimating Capital Expenditure: Failing to accurately budget for the necessary capital expenditure required for upgrades, maintenance, or expansion of mining infrastructure. This includes processing plants, equipment, and site development.
- Ignoring Environmental and Social Factors: Overlooking environmental impact assessments, rehabilitation obligations, and community relations. Non-compliance can lead to significant fines, operational shutdowns, and reputational damage.
- Misjudging Market Volatility: Investing based solely on current high commodity prices without considering long-term market fluctuations. A robust analysis of commodity cycles and future demand is essential.
- Lack of Local Expertise: Attempting to navigate the South African mining regulatory landscape and operational environment without local expertise. Understanding local laws, customs, and labor dynamics is critical.
- Insufficient Operational Planning: Not having a clear, actionable operational plan post-acquisition, including staffing, supply chain management, and production targets.
